0:32 Saying either true or false is ok for statements or groups of statemens that are not inherently contradictory. But as an overall law encompassing any staement I think the correct dichotomy is "Every statement is either true or not true". That way we avoid paradoxes like "This statement is false" which are considered neither true nor false sometimes.
